Phillies vs Braves Preview
The Philadelphia Phillies are set to take on the Atlanta Braves at Truist Park. The game will begin at 7:15 PM and will be shown on FOX. The weather is expected to be warm with a clear sky and a light breeze, providing a pleasant atmosphere for fans.
Jesús Luzardo will start for the Phillies. He has a 4.08 ERA and a 1.37 WHIP with a 7-3 record. Spencer Schwellenbach will pitch for the Braves. He has a 3.21 ERA and a 0.99 WHIP with a 6-4 record. Both pitchers have shown strong performances this season, making this game an exciting matchup.
Atlanta Braves: Power at the Plate and Precision on the Mound
The Atlanta Braves have a strong lineup of hitters. Matt Olson leads the team with 15 home runs and 52 RBIs. Austin Riley is also a key player, with 12 home runs and 45 runs scored. Marcell Ozuna adds depth to the batting order with his .247 average and 11 home runs. Ozzie Albies, although hitting .223, has contributed 35 runs. Drake Baldwin shows promise with a .281 average and 9 home runs in 55 games. On the mound, Spencer Schwellenbach stands out with a 3.21 ERA. He has a WHIP of 0.99 and a record of 6-4. The Braves’ pitching staff ranks 12th in ERA and 7th in batting average against, showing their effectiveness in games.
Philadelphia Phillies: Strong Bats and Steady Arms
The Phillies have a solid lineup of hitters. Kyle Schwarber leads the team with 25 home runs and 57 RBIs. Trea Turner follows with a .302 batting average and 11 home runs. Bryce Harper adds strength with a .258 average and 9 home runs in 57 games. The Phillies’ pitching staff is reliable. Jesús Luzardo will start with a 4.08 ERA and a 7-3 record. The team’s overall ERA is 3.76, placing them 10th in the league. They have recorded 753 strikeouts, ranking 2nd. As a team, the Phillies have a batting average of .256. They rank 3rd in on-base percentage with .329. Their slugging percentage is .405, placing them 10th. The Phillies have hit 88 home runs this season.
